Index: 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js =================================================================== diff -u -r29707 -r29708 --- 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js (.../goodsApplicationView.js) (revision 29707) +++ ssts-web/src/main/webapp/disinfectsystem/recyclingApplication/goodsApplicationView.js (.../goodsApplicationView.js) (revision 29708) @@ -2210,7 +2210,7 @@ showResult('请先在printConfig.js里面配置物资编码'); return; } - var records = Ext.getCmp('recordListStoreGrid').getSelectionModel().getSelections(); + var records = top.Ext.getCmp('recordListStoreGrid').getSelectionModel().getSelections(); var printRecordIds = []; if(records.length == 0){ showResult('请至少选择一条批次'); @@ -2264,17 +2264,6 @@ }); } -var sm = new Ext.grid.CheckboxSelectionModel({ - singleSelect : false -}); - -var tousseCm = new Ext.grid.ColumnModel([sm, - {id : 'printRecordId',dataIndex : 'printRecordId',hidden : true}, - {header : "打印开始时间",dataIndex : 'startTime',menuDisabled : true}, - {header : "班次名称",dataIndex : 'shift',menuDisabled : true}, - {header : "打印人",dataIndex : 'printUser',menuDisabled : true} -]); - var recordListStore = new Ext.data.Store({ proxy : new Ext.data.HttpProxy({ url : WWWROOT + '/disinfectSystem/invoicePlanPrintRecordAction!findInvoicePlanPrintRecordList.do', @@ -2291,7 +2280,7 @@ ]), listeners : { beforeload: function(s,options){ - var beginTime = Ext.getCmp('beginTime').getValue(); + var beginTime = top.Ext.getCmp('beginTime').getValue(); if(!isUndefinedOrNullOrEmpty(beginTime)){ var time = date2string(new Date(beginTime)) s.baseParams.startDate = time.split(' ')[0]; @@ -2306,7 +2295,7 @@ var beginTime = ""; var endTime = ""; - var formPanel = new Ext.FormPanel({ + var formPanel = new top.Ext.FormPanel({ id : 'form', frame : true, labelSeparator : ':', @@ -2319,6 +2308,7 @@ layout : 'column', autoHeight : true, bodyStyle : 'padding:5px 5px 0px 5px;', + style:'margin-bottom:0', id:"tops", items : [{ columnWidth : 0.5, @@ -2350,18 +2340,26 @@ }] },{ columnWidth :1, - items:[new Ext.grid.EditorGridPanel({ + items:[new top.Ext.grid.GridPanel({ id : 'recordListStoreGrid', store : recordListStore, - cm : tousseCm, + sm :new top.Ext.grid.CheckboxSelectionModel ({singleSelect : false}), + cm : new top.Ext.grid.ColumnModel([new top.Ext.grid.CheckboxSelectionModel ({singleSelect : false}), + {id : 'printRecordId',dataIndex : 'printRecordId',hidden : true}, + {header : "打印开始时间",dataIndex : 'startTime',menuDisabled : true}, + {header : "班次名称",dataIndex : 'shift',menuDisabled : true}, + {header : "打印人",dataIndex : 'printUser',menuDisabled : true} + ]), height:200, width:570, bodyStyle : 'border:1px solid #afd7af;border-top:0', frame : false, viewConfig: { forceFit:true }, - selModel :sm + selModel : new top.Ext.grid.RowSelectionModel({ + singleSelect : false + }), })] } ], buttons : [{ @@ -2385,7 +2383,7 @@ }] }); - var printRecordListWin = new Ext.Window( { + var printRecordListWin = new top.Ext.Window( { id : 'printRecordListWin', layout : 'fit', title : '打印一次性物品汇总单 ', @@ -2404,7 +2402,7 @@ var result = Ext.decode(response.responseText); if (result.success) { var startDateTime = result.data.startDateTime; - Ext.getCmp('beginTime').setValue(startDateTime); + top.Ext.getCmp('beginTime').setValue(startDateTime); printRecordListWin.show(); recordListStore.load() } else {